Output 7dd7b7715ddfd7af9d2ee99a9139eed1f7986ef503821ec97e53b92d0abde12a:0

value
106500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75807c828220db5878f819edb8a76a4b8e0265f1 OP_EQUAL
address
3CQJuNq1hTkKdaFWK4T4jC4mrMwLqMX3hU
transaction
7dd7b7715ddfd7af9d2ee99a9139eed1f7986ef503821ec97e53b92d0abde12a
spent
true